Carbon monoxide (CO) is a colourless, odourless gas produced by incomplete combustion of fuels. Exposure to carbon monoxide can interfere with the body’s ability to transport oxygen and may lead to serious health consequences.
Carbon monoxide poisoning is a medical emergency and requires immediate assessment and treatment by emergency services or hospital-based medical teams.

Hyperbaric Oxygen Therapy involves breathing high-concentration oxygen inside a pressurised chamber. Under increased atmospheric pressure, oxygen dissolves more efficiently into the bloodstream and body fluids, increasing overall oxygen availability throughout the body.
